Why will my gas water heater not light?

Why will my gas water heater not light?

If you have a natural or propane gas water heater, chances are the pilot has gone out. If the pilot doesn’t relight, if it goes out right after lighting or if it goes out repeatedly, by far the most common cause is a bad thermocouple.

What is the status light on a water heater?

A solid red status light means the water heater is shutting down. Turn the gas control valve OFF and wait 10 minutes before attempting to relight the pilot. The status light will flash more than once every 3 seconds if an error is detected.

What happens to my gas water heater during a power outage?

If your gas water heater uses a continuous gas pilot light, it is likely that your gas water heater will continue to function normally in the event of a power outage.

How can I see if there is a flame under my water heater?

Depending on your water heater, you can actually see if there is a flame underneath the tank. Turn the pilot light knob onto “pilot”. Press down on the knob and hold down the ignite button for a minute to turn the flame back on.

What to do if your gas water heater is not lit?

Gas water heater: If your unit has a pilot light and it isn’t lit, follow the instructions in your user’s manual to relight the pilot using the BBQ lighter. If the unit has an electronic ignition and it won’t fire, the ignition might require replacing.

Why is my water heater light not working?

If you have a very weak pilot that will only light with a grill lighter (not the piezo igniter)then a dirty orifice is the most likely culprit. Poor gas pressure is another possibility but you’d need a gas pressure gauge (reads in inches of water column) or a manometer to check that.

Why is the gas valve on my water heater not opening?

It detects whether your pilot light is lit by generating a small electrical current powered by the heat of the pilot flame. The gas valve won’t open if it doesn’t sense the small electrical current produced by the thermocouple because it assumes the pilot light is off.
